How does glow in the dark tape work?

Glow-in-the-dark tape is made just like normal vinyl tape except it also has a phosphor applied to it. This phosphor will absorb light radiation into it and emit it back out, which is where the glowing comes from. Whenever the tape is exposed to any type of light it will begin absorbing the radiation.

How does black reflective tape work?

Reflective tape (also known as retro-reflective tape) works by reflecting light back to the light source only. ... If both shined a light down the street they would both see the tape. This happens because the tape contains either glass beads or prisms that collect light, focus it and bounce it back to the source.21 ene 2011

How do you charge glow in the dark tape?

Glow in the dark materials DO need a charge Approximate charge times for glow in the dark products are as follows: 3-4 mins of ultra violet (black) light. 7-8 mins of direct sunlight. 21-23 mins of fluorescent light (strip lighting or energy saving bulbs)
